Reasons Why Outlook Doesn’t Sync with Gmail

While we begin any action, we must first understand why Outlook 365 not syncing with Gmail. So, here are some topics relating to this issue in the following paragraphs:

  • Windows upgrades often can prevent the IMAP connection from working.
  • Outlook folder reorganization.
  • A faulty network connection may prevent Outlook from syncing with Gmail.
  • Outlook’s PST size limitation prevents synchronization at one point.
  • Incorrect Google account settings might be a factor influencing synchronization.
  • Owing to a corrupted data file.

Method 2. Look if There Is Any Faulty Windows Update Available

If you notice the “Outlook 365 not syncing with Gmail” issue, you should verify the Windows updates running on your computer. Some erroneous or undesired upgrades might cause this problem. Like KB2837618 and KB2837643, some updates prohibit IMAP folders from syncing properly.

For syncing with Gmail, Outlook should be set to utilize IMAP. For re-syncing your accounts, you will have to remove these unwanted updates. Microsoft recommends delaying the upgrade as much as necessary until the problem is rectified and a new version is available.

Method 4: Verify Your Gmail POP and Gmail IMAP Server settings

For IMAP Server Settings:

IMAP enables users to read their Gmail messages in some other emails, including Outlook 365. This can be used in several systems in real time. You need to follow the below procedures to make sure that the IMAP is enabled in your Gmail account:

Step 1: You need to open your Gmail account and click the settings option present on the top right side of the screen. Then, select the “See All Settings” option.

quick settings

Step 3: You will have to hit on the “Forwarding and POP/IMAP” tab.

Forwarding and POP/IMAP

Step 4: Following this, choose the “Enable IMAP” option in the “IMAP Access” and then hit on the “Save Changes” option.

Enable IMAP

Step 5: After the IMAP settings, you will have to alter the SMTP and other configurations in Outlook. Follow the below table and set your settings accordingly:

Incoming Mail (IMAP) ServerImap.gmail.com Requires SSL: Yes Port: 993
Outgoing Mail (SMTP) ServerSmtp.gmail.com Requires SSL: Yes Requires TLS: Yes (if there) Requires Authentication: Yes Port for SSL: 465 Port for TLS/START TLS: 587
Display Name or Full NameUser’s name
Account Name, User Name, or Email AddressUser’s email
PasswordUser’s Gmail Password

For POP Server Settings

Once you are done with the IMAP settings, you need to do the same thing with the POP server setting. POP also performs a similar function as the IMAP settings. The only difference is that POP serves only one system. It does not enable you to sync email in real time, but you can download it and decide the download frequency. The steps to configure the POP settings to download it are:

Step 1: You need to open your Gmail account and click the settings option present on the top right side of the screen. Then, select the “See All Settings” option.

Step 2: You will have to hit on the “Forwarding and POP/IMAP” tab.

Step 3:  Following this, choose the “Enable POP for mail that arrives from now” or “Enable POP for all mail” option in the “POP Download” and then hit on the “Save Changes” option.

Step 4: Lastly, enter the incoming and outgoing mail server settings in your Outlook account as below:

Incoming Mail (POP) Serverpop.gmail.com Requires SSL: Yes Port: 995
Outgoing Mail (SMTP) ServerSmtp.gmail.com Requires SSL: Yes Requires TLS: Yes (if there) Requires Authentication: Yes Port for TLS/START TLS: 587
Server TimeoutsGreater than 1 minute
Display Name or Full NameUser’s name
Account Name, User Name, or Email AddressUser’s email
PasswordUser’s Gmail Password

Method 7: Remove and Re-Add Your Gmail Account

Occasionally, despite adjusting settings and troubleshooting, the most efficient solution to resolve syncing issues is by removing and then re-adding the Gmail account in Outlook. Rest assured, this process won’t result in data loss as your emails are stored on Google’s servers, not your local computer. 

Remove and Re-Add Your Gmail Account

To proceed, access Outlook’s “File,” navigate to “Account and Social Settings,” and select “Account Settings” to delete and subsequently re-add your Gmail account for a seamless syncing experience.

By deleting and re-adding the Gmail account, you can create a fresh connection between Outlook and Google’s servers, potentially resolving any sync hiccups. This straightforward approach often helps overcome complexities that arise from conflicting configurations. Remember to have your Gmail account login credentials handy to quickly set up the account again after removal.

Method 8: Repair Outlook Data File

Still, stuck with the “Gmail not syncing with Outlook” issue? Well, you have another valuable option at your disposal – the “Inbox Repair Tool,” also known as “scanpst.exe.” This indispensable tool is an integral part of Outlook’s toolkit, designed specifically to address data file corruption and inconsistencies that could be hindering the syncing process.

To initiate the repair process with the Inbox Repair Tool, follow these steps:

Step 1: Close Outlook to ensure no active processes are accessing the data file.

Step 2:  Locate the “scanpst.exe” tool on your computer. Its default location varies depending on the version of Outlook and the operating system, but you can usually find it in the “Office” or “Outlook” program folder.

Repair Outlook Data File to fix Gmail not fixing issue

Step 3: Double-click on “scanpst.exe” to launch the tool. A small window will appear, prompting you to browse and select the Outlook data file you wish to repair. The data file has a “.pst” extension and is usually named “Outlook.pst.”

Step 4: Once you have selected the data file, click on the “Start” button to initiate the scanning and repair process. The tool will meticulously analyze the file’s structure, searching for any errors or inconsistencies.

Step 5: If the tool detects any issues, it will present you with a summary of the problems found. Click on the “Repair” button to commence the repair process.

Microsoft Outbox Inbox Repair Tool

Step 6: The repair process might take some time, depending on the size and complexity of the data file. Be patient and allow the tool to complete its task.

Step 7: After the repair is finished, the tool will provide a report detailing the actions taken and the results. Examine the report to ensure that the errors have been successfully repaired.

Step 8: Finally, open Outlook again and verify if the syncing issue has been resolved. The repaired data file should now function optimally, enabling seamless synchronization with your Gmail account.

It’s essential to keep in mind that the Inbox Repair Tool might not be able to repair severely damaged or heavily corrupted data files. In such cases, consider restoring from a backup or consulting professional IT services to salvage your data.
